diff --git a/opendj-server-legacy/src/main/java/org/opends/server/extensions/AbstractPBKDF2PasswordStorageScheme.java b/opendj-server-legacy/src/main/java/org/opends/server/extensions/AbstractPBKDF2PasswordStorageScheme.java
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..c8d770c
--- /dev/null
+++ b/opendj-server-legacy/src/main/java/org/opends/server/extensions/AbstractPBKDF2PasswordStorageScheme.java
@@ -0,0 +1,338 @@
+package org.opends.server.extensions;
+
+import org.forgerock.i18n.LocalizableMessage;
+import org.forgerock.i18n.slf4j.LocalizedLogger;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.config.server.ConfigChangeResult;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.config.server.ConfigException;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.config.server.ConfigurationChangeListener;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.ldap.Base64;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.ldap.ByteSequence;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.ldap.ByteString;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.ldap.ResultCode;
+import org.forgerock.opendj.server.config.server.PBKDF2PasswordStorageSchemeCfg;
+import org.opends.server.api.PasswordStorageScheme;
+import org.opends.server.core.DirectoryServer;
+import org.opends.server.types.DirectoryException;
+import org.opends.server.types.InitializationException;
+
+import javax.crypto.SecretKey;
+import javax.crypto.SecretKeyFactory;
+import javax.crypto.spec.PBEKeySpec;
+import java.security.NoSuchAlgorithmException;
+import java.security.SecureRandom;
+import java.security.spec.InvalidKeySpecException;
+import java.util.Arrays;
+import java.util.List;
+
+import static org.opends.messages.ExtensionMessages.*;
+import static org.opends.server.util.StaticUtils.getExceptionMessage;
+
+abstract class AbstractPBKDF2PasswordStorageScheme
+        extends PasswordStorageScheme<PBKDF2PasswordStorageSchemeCfg>
+        implements ConfigurationChangeListener<PBKDF2PasswordStorageSchemeCfg>
+{
+    private static final LocalizedLogger logger = LocalizedLogger.getLoggerForThisClass();
+
+    /** The number of bytes of random data to use as the salt when generating the hashes. */
+    private static final int NUM_SALT_BYTES = 8;
+
+    /** The chosen digest algorithm. */
+    private SecretKeyFactory keyFactory;
+
+    /** The secure random number generator to use to generate the salt values. */
+    private SecureRandom random;
+
+    /** The current configuration for this storage scheme. */
+    private volatile PBKDF2PasswordStorageSchemeCfg config;
+
+    /**
+     * Creates a new instance of this password storage scheme.  Note that no
+     * initialization should be performed here, as all initialization should be
+     * done in the <CODE>initializePasswordStorageScheme</CODE> method.
+     */
+    public AbstractPBKDF2PasswordStorageScheme()
+    {
+        super();
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public void initializePasswordStorageScheme(PBKDF2PasswordStorageSchemeCfg configuration)
+            throws ConfigException, InitializationException
+    {
+        try
+        {
+            random = new SecureRandom();
+            // Initialize the digest algorithm
+            keyFactory = SecretKeyFactory.getInstance(getMessageDigestAlgorithm());
+        }
+        catch (NoSuchAlgorithmException e)
+        {
+            throw new InitializationException(null);
+        }
+
+        this.config = configuration;
+        config.addPBKDF2ChangeListener(this);
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public boolean isConfigurationChangeAcceptable(PBKDF2PasswordStorageSchemeCfg configuration,
+                                                   List<LocalizableMessage> unacceptableReasons)
+    {
+        return true;
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public ConfigChangeResult applyConfigurationChange(PBKDF2PasswordStorageSchemeCfg configuration)
+    {
+        this.config = configuration;
+        return new ConfigChangeResult();
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public abstract String getStorageSchemeName();
+
+    @Override
+    public ByteString encodePassword(ByteSequence plaintext)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        byte[] saltBytes      = new byte[NUM_SALT_BYTES];
+        int    iterations     = config.getPBKDF2Iterations();
+
+        SecretKey digest = encodeWithRandomSalt(plaintext, saltBytes, iterations);
+        byte[] hashPlusSalt = concatenateHashPlusSalt(saltBytes, digest.getEncoded());
+
+        return ByteString.valueOfUtf8(iterations + ":" + Base64.encode(hashPlusSalt));
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public ByteString encodePasswordWithScheme(ByteSequence plaintext)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        return ByteString.valueOfUtf8('{' + getStorageSchemeName() + '}' + encodePassword(plaintext));
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public boolean passwordMatches(ByteSequence plaintextPassword, ByteSequence storedPassword) {
+        // Split the iterations from the stored value (separated by a ':')
+        // Base64-decode the remaining value and take the last bytes as the salt.
+        try
+        {
+            final String stored = storedPassword.toString();
+            final int pos = stored.indexOf(':');
+            if (pos == -1)
+            {
+                throw new Exception();
+            }
+
+            final int iterations = Integer.parseInt(stored.substring(0, pos));
+            byte[] decodedBytes = Base64.decode(stored.substring(pos + 1)).toByteArray();
+
+            int digestLength = getDigestSize();
+            final int saltLength = decodedBytes.length - digestLength;
+            if (saltLength <= 0) {
+                logger.error(ERR_PWSCHEME_INVALID_BASE64_DECODED_STORED_PASSWORD, storedPassword);
+                return false;
+            }
+
+            final byte[] digestBytes = new byte[digestLength];
+            final byte[] saltBytes = new byte[saltLength];
+            System.arraycopy(decodedBytes, 0, digestBytes, 0, digestLength);
+            System.arraycopy(decodedBytes, digestLength, saltBytes, 0, saltLength);
+            return encodeAndMatch(plaintextPassword, saltBytes, digestBytes, iterations);
+        }
+        catch (Exception e)
+        {
+            logger.traceException(e);
+            logger.error(ERR_PWSCHEME_CANNOT_BASE64_DECODE_STORED_PASSWORD, storedPassword, e);
+            return false;
+        }
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public boolean supportsAuthPasswordSyntax()
+    {
+        return true;
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public abstract String getAuthPasswordSchemeName();
+
+    abstract String getMessageDigestAlgorithm();
+
+    abstract int getDigestSize();
+
+    @Override
+    public ByteString encodeAuthPassword(ByteSequence plaintext)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        byte[] saltBytes      = new byte[NUM_SALT_BYTES];
+        int    iterations     = config.getPBKDF2Iterations();
+        SecretKey digest = encodeWithRandomSalt(plaintext, saltBytes, iterations);
+        byte[] digestBytes = digest.getEncoded();
+
+        // Encode and return the value.
+        return ByteString.valueOfUtf8(getAuthPasswordSchemeName() + '$'
+                + iterations + ':' + Base64.encode(saltBytes) + '$' + Base64.encode(digestBytes));
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public boolean authPasswordMatches(ByteSequence plaintextPassword, String authInfo, String authValue)
+    {
+        try
+        {
+            int pos = authInfo.indexOf(':');
+            if (pos == -1)
+            {
+                throw new Exception();
+            }
+            int iterations = Integer.parseInt(authInfo.substring(0, pos));
+            byte[] saltBytes   = Base64.decode(authInfo.substring(pos + 1)).toByteArray();
+            byte[] digestBytes = Base64.decode(authValue).toByteArray();
+            return encodeAndMatch(plaintextPassword, saltBytes, digestBytes, iterations);
+        }
+        catch (Exception e)
+        {
+            logger.traceException(e);
+            return false;
+        }
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public boolean isReversible()
+    {
+        return false;
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public ByteString getPlaintextValue(ByteSequence storedPassword)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        LocalizableMessage message = ERR_PWSCHEME_NOT_REVERSIBLE.get(getStorageSchemeName());
+        throw new DirectoryException(ResultCode.CONSTRAINT_VIOLATION, message);
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public ByteString getAuthPasswordPlaintextValue(String authInfo, String authValue)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        LocalizableMessage message = ERR_PWSCHEME_NOT_REVERSIBLE.get(getAuthPasswordSchemeName());
+        throw new DirectoryException(ResultCode.CONSTRAINT_VIOLATION, message);
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public boolean isStorageSchemeSecure()
+    {
+        return true;
+    }
+
+    /**
+     * Generates an encoded password string from the given clear-text password.
+     * This method is primarily intended for use when it is necessary to generate a password with the server
+     * offline (e.g., when setting the initial root user password).
+     *
+     * @param  passwordBytes  The bytes that make up the clear-text password.
+     * @param schemeName The storage scheme name
+     * @param digestAlgo The digest algorithm name
+     * @param digestSize The digest algorithm size in bytes
+     * @return  The encoded password string, including the scheme name in curly braces.
+     * @throws  DirectoryException  If a problem occurs during processing.
+     */
+    public static String encodeOffline(byte[] passwordBytes, String schemeName, String digestAlgo, int digestSize)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        byte[] saltBytes      = new byte[NUM_SALT_BYTES];
+        final int iterations  = 10000;
+
+        SecureRandom random = new SecureRandom();
+        random.nextBytes(saltBytes);
+
+        final ByteString password = ByteString.wrap(passwordBytes);
+        char[] plaintextChars = password.toString().toCharArray();
+
+        PBEKeySpec spec = null;
+        try {
+            SecretKeyFactory factory = SecretKeyFactory.getInstance(digestAlgo);
+            spec = new PBEKeySpec(plaintextChars, saltBytes, iterations, digestSize * 8);
+            SecretKey digest = factory.generateSecret(spec);
+            byte[] digestBytes = digest.getEncoded();
+            byte[] hashPlusSalt = concatenateHashPlusSalt(saltBytes, digestBytes);
+
+            return '{' + schemeName + '}' + iterations + ':' + Base64.encode(hashPlusSalt);
+        } catch (InvalidKeySpecException | NoSuchAlgorithmException e)
+        {
+            throw cannotEncodePassword(schemeName, e);
+        }
+        finally {
+            Arrays.fill(plaintextChars, '0');
+
+            if (spec != null)
+                spec.clearPassword();
+        }
+    }
+
+    private SecretKey encodeWithRandomSalt(ByteString plaintext, byte[] saltBytes, int iterations)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        random.nextBytes(saltBytes);
+        return encodeWithRandomSalt(plaintext, saltBytes, iterations);
+    }
+
+    private SecretKey encodeWithSalt(ByteSequence plaintext, byte[] saltBytes, int iterations)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        final char[] plaintextChars = plaintext.toString().toCharArray();
+
+        PBEKeySpec spec = null;
+        try
+        {
+            spec = new PBEKeySpec(plaintextChars, saltBytes, iterations, getDigestSize() * 8);
+            return keyFactory.generateSecret(spec);
+        }
+        catch (Exception e)
+        {
+            throw cannotEncodePassword(getStorageSchemeName(), e);
+        }
+        finally
+        {
+            Arrays.fill(plaintextChars, '0');
+            if (spec != null)
+                spec.clearPassword();
+        }
+    }
+
+    private boolean encodeAndMatch(ByteSequence plaintext, byte[] saltBytes, byte[] digestBytes, int iterations)
+    {
+        try
+        {
+            final SecretKey userDigestBytes = encodeWithSalt(plaintext, saltBytes, iterations);
+            return Arrays.equals(digestBytes, userDigestBytes.getEncoded());
+        }
+        catch (Exception e)
+        {
+            return false;
+        }
+    }
+
+    private SecretKey encodeWithRandomSalt(ByteSequence plaintext, byte[] saltBytes, int iterations)
+            throws DirectoryException
+    {
+        random.nextBytes(saltBytes);
+        return encodeWithSalt(plaintext, saltBytes, iterations);
+    }
+
+    private static DirectoryException cannotEncodePassword(String storageSchemeName, Exception e)
+    {
+        logger.traceException(e);
+
+        LocalizableMessage message = ERR_PWSCHEME_CANNOT_ENCODE_PASSWORD.get(
+                storageSchemeName, getExceptionMessage(e));
+        return new DirectoryException(DirectoryServer.getCoreConfigManager().getServerErrorResultCode(), message, e);
+    }
+
+    private static byte[] concatenateHashPlusSalt(byte[] saltBytes, byte[] digestBytes) {
+        final byte[] hashPlusSalt = new byte[digestBytes.length + saltBytes.length];
+        System.arraycopy(digestBytes, 0, hashPlusSalt, 0, digestBytes.length);
+        System.arraycopy(saltBytes, 0, hashPlusSalt, digestBytes.length, saltBytes.length);
+        return hashPlusSalt;
+    }
+}

diff --git a/opendj-server-legacy/src/main/java/org/opends/server/extensions/PBKDF2HmacSHA256PasswordStorageScheme.java b/opendj-server-legacy/src/main/java/org/opends/server/extensions/PBKDF2HmacSHA256PasswordStorageScheme.java
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..9d8e604
--- /dev/null
+++ b/opendj-server-legacy/src/main/java/org/opends/server/extensions/PBKDF2HmacSHA256PasswordStorageScheme.java
@@ -0,0 +1,53 @@
+/*
+ * The contents of this file are subject to the terms of the Common Development and
+ * Distribution License (the License). You may not use this file except in compliance with the
+ * License.
+ *
+ * You can obtain a copy of the License at legal/CDDLv1.0.txt. See the License for the
+ * specific language governing permission and limitations under the License.
+ *
+ * When distributing Covered Software, include this CDDL Header Notice in each file and include
+ * the License file at legal/CDDLv1.0.txt. If applicable, add the following below the CDDL
+ * Header, with the fields enclosed by brackets [] replaced by your own identifying
+ * information: "Portions Copyright [year] [name of copyright owner]".
+ *
+ * Copyright 2013-2016 ForgeRock AS.
+ */
+package org.opends.server.extensions;
+
+import org.opends.server.types.DirectoryException;
+
+import static org.opends.server.extensions.ExtensionsConstants.*;
+
+/**
+ * This class defines a Directory Server password storage scheme based on the
+ * PBKDF2 algorithm defined in RFC 2898.  This is a one-way digest algorithm
+ * so there is no way to retrieve the original clear-text version of the
+ * password from the hashed value (although this means that it is not suitable
+ * for things that need the clear-text password like DIGEST-MD5).  This
+ * implementation uses a configurable number of iterations.
+ */
+public class PBKDF2HmacSHA256PasswordStorageScheme
+    extends AbstractPBKDF2PasswordStorageScheme
+{
+  public String getStorageSchemeName() {
+    return STORAGE_SCHEME_NAME_PBKDF2_HMAC_SHA256;
+  }
+
+  public String getAuthPasswordSchemeName() {
+    return AUTH_PASSWORD_SCHEME_NAME_PBKDF2_HMAC_SHA256;
+  }
+
+  String getMessageDigestAlgorithm() {
+    return MESSAGE_DIGEST_ALGORITHM_PBKDF2_HMAC_SHA256;
+  }
+
+  int getDigestSize() {
+    return 32;
+  }
+
+  public static String encodeOffline(byte[] passwordBytes) throws DirectoryException {
+    return encodeOffline(passwordBytes,
+            AUTH_PASSWORD_SCHEME_NAME_PBKDF2_HMAC_SHA256, MESSAGE_DIGEST_ALGORITHM_PBKDF2_HMAC_SHA256, 32);
+  }
+}
